We offer bulk-billed podiatry services to eligible white and gold DVA card holders.
All Studio Podiatry locations accept Department of Veterans Affairs (DVA) patients with a valid D904 referral from your General Practitioner (GP).
The D904 referral grants you access to either 12 months of Podiatry care or up to 12 Podiatry appointments, whichever occurs first. If you exhaust your 12 appointments within the 12-month timeframe, obtaining a new D904 referral from your GP is necessary to continue treatment.
Additionally, there is no restriction on the number of referrals your GP can provide, and we will promptly inform you when a new referral is required.

Medical-grade footwear for DVA patients is specifically designed to provide superior comfort, support, and protection for those with foot conditions. These shoes are often prescribed to veterans to alleviate pain, prevent injuries, and improve mobility. Featuring features such as extra depth, cushioned soles, and adjustable fastenings, medical-grade footwear helps reduce the risk of complications like pressure sores and ulcers, ensuring long-term foot health for veterans.
